On Sunday, Cork will have four survivors and Tipperary two in their squads from their last and inaugural senior hurling championship meeting in Croke Park.
Munster champions Cork were caught cold by a Tipperary team who had stormed their way through the qualifiers and won that All-Ireland semi-final by 10 points.
